Swedish potato sausage. Isterband korv are part of a group of Swedish sausages known as hängekorv (hanging sausages). This means that the sausages are hung to dry in a draughty place, just below room temperature, for 3 or 4 days. It is this process which allows lactic acid bacteria to thrive and give the sausage its slightly sour flavour.

Tony’s Andouille Sausage: Traditional Cajun sausage great in gumbos or on the smoker.So just for clarification. Scandinavians used to be poor for some time. Sweden was known as the poor house of Europe in the 19th century. You would stretch any meat or food with what ever was available. Tree bark was common, but potato was better. Potatiskorv (more commonly known as värmlandskorv in Sweden) is a regional Swedish sausage from Värmland, made with ground pork, beef, onions, and potatoes. Potatiskorv is traditionally served hot at Christmas in Värmland but often served hot or cold throughout the year. Originally a specialty from the Swedish province of Värmland and called Värmlandskorv, this uncooked sausage is made from potatoes, onions, pork and beef.Grind the trimmings through the fine plate, change the plate to coarse and grind the pork butts together with the trimmings. Grind this meat together with the potatoes a second time through the coarse plate. Combine salt, pepper and onions in ice cold water, pour over the meat and mix well. Stuff into 32/35 mm hog …
